反应信息

  • 作为产物:
    描述:
    12-(4-fluorophenyl)-9,9-dimethyl-9,10-dihydro-8H-benzo[a]xanthene-11(12H)-one劳森试剂 作用下, 以 甲苯 为溶剂, 反应 0.75h, 以88%的产率得到9,9-dimethyl-12-(4-fluorophenyl)-8,9,10,12-tetrahydrobenzo[a]xanthene-11-thione
    参考文献:
    名称:
    Synthesis of novel 12-aryl-8,9,10,12-tetrahydrobenzo[a]xanthene-11-thiones and evaluation of their biocidal effects
    摘要:
    Novel 12-aryl-8,9,10,12-tetrahydrobenzolakanthene-11-thiones have been synthesized in high yields by treatment of the corresponding oxo analogs with Lawesson's reagent. The structure has been confirmed by X-ray analysis. The compounds were tested for in vitro antifungal activity against Rhizoctonia bataticola, Sclerotium rolfsii, Fusarium oxysporum and Alternaria porii. The compounds exhibited moderate to good activity against all pathogens. Insecticidal activity of these compounds against Spodoptera litura was observed to be comparable to commercial pyrethroid insecticide, cypermethrin. The urease inhibitory activity has also been studied. (C) 2012 Elsevier Masson SAS. All rights reserved.

  • Synthesis, Spectroscopic Analysis, and In-Vitro Antimicrobial Evaluation of some Tetrahydrobenzo[a]Xanthene-11-Thiones
    作者:Annamalai Sethukumar、Chandran Udhaya Kumar、Balasubramaniyam Arul Prakasam
    DOI:10.1080/10426507.2012.757611
    日期:2013.11.1
    A series of 12-aryl-8,9,10,12-tetrahydrobenzo[a]xanthene-11-thiones were synthesized by the reaction of substituted 12-aryl-8,9,10,12-tetrahydrobenzo[a]xanthene-11-ones with Lawesson's Reagent in toluene under standard reaction conditions. All synthesized compounds were characterized by IR, NMR (H-1 and C-13), and mass spectra. Moreover, 2D-NMR (HOMOCOSY, HSQC, and HMBC) studies were also performed for compound 10b. The synthesized compounds were also screened for their antibacterial activities. [Supplementary materials are available for this article.
